This is a bill that is being debated at the national level contemplated by the draft “Law on the Protection and Rights of Animals”, which has already been presented and is awaiting approval.
While it was clarified that it would be a microchip compatible document, It was also reported that the objective would be to change the lives of pets, for example, through the obligation to take a training course before wanting to adopt.
Spain has exceeded 300,000 abandoned animals for several years, including more than 160,000 dogs and more than 120,000 cats.
On the other hand, it is also contemplated that only fish may be sold in veterinarians, that the raising of pets between individuals is prohibited and that the number of animals that can live in the same house is limited to five. The latter is not retroactive, so if the person exceeds this number, they will not have to stop living with any of them.
In the event that a couple has a divorce, they would become sentient beings. There, the judge will have to decide which member is the right one to keep his custody.
Nor can they be left alone without supervision for more than three days and, if they are dogs, not more than 24 hours.
Sergio García Torres, director of Animal Rights, said that this law seeks “zero sacrifice.” Animals can only be sacrificed in case of justified euthanasia and under veterinary control and in very specific cases. Any other will be expressly prohibited.
